Collaborative Robots: Breaking Down Barriers

Collaborative robots, also known as cobots, have transformed the landscape of human-robot interaction. Designed to work alongside human operators, these robots enable efficient collaboration, freeing up workers from repetitive tasks and allowing them to focus on higher-value activities. ABB's YuMi robot is a prime example of a collaborative robot, renowned for its advanced sensor technology and user-friendly design.

Benefits of Deploying ABB Robots

The benefits of deploying ABB robots extend far beyond increased productivity and efficiency.

Enhanced Quality: ABB robots deliver consistent performance, reducing variability and improving product quality.

Increased Safety: Robots remove humans from hazardous tasks, minimizing workplace accidents and injuries.

Reduced Costs: Automation reduces labor costs and minimizes material waste, leading to significant cost savings.

Improved Flexibility: Robots can be easily reprogrammed to adapt to changing production needs, enhancing flexibility and responsiveness.

Tips and Tricks for Effective ABB Robot Integration

Conduct a Thorough Needs Assessment:

Before investing in ABB robots, it's crucial to conduct a thorough needs assessment to identify specific requirements, application scenarios, and potential benefits.

Choose the Right Robot Model:

ABB offers a diverse portfolio of robots. Selecting the right model for your specific application ensures optimal performance and return on investment.

Plan for Integration:

Effective robot integration requires careful planning. Consider factors such as workspace layout, robot programming, and operator training.

Invest in Maintenance:

Regular maintenance is essential to ensure optimal robot performance and longevity. Implement a preventive maintenance program to identify and address potential issues promptly.

Potential Drawbacks of ABB Robots

Initial Investment:

ABB robots represent a significant investment. Organizations must carefully consider the upfront costs and ensure a sound business case.

Technical Complexity:

Robot integration and programming require specialized knowledge and expertise. Organizations may need to invest in training or outsource these tasks.

Power Consumption:

Industrial robots consume a substantial amount of electricity. Organizations should factor in energy costs when evaluating the total cost of ownership.

Frequently Asked Questions (FAQs)

Q1: What is the difference between a collaborative robot and a traditional industrial robot?
A1: Collaborative robots, also known as cobots, are designed to work alongside human operators, while traditional industrial robots are typically used in isolated environments.

Q2: How do I choose the right ABB robot model for my application?
A2: Consider factors such as payload capacity, reach, speed, and application requirements. Consult with an ABB representative to determine the optimal model.
